I was referred to 'Takes Care' (not) in early/mid July. In addition to the GP referral, I called and was told that there was a 4 month wait, but books were open, and I would hear from them within the week. Fast forward to the end of July when I again followed up because I had heard nothing from them and this time I also re-emailed the referral. Again, nothing. In mid August I called once more and was informed that they 'couldn't find' my referral. After a while, it was found and I was again told I'd hear back in a day or two. Today (22/08) I called again after not hearing back and was told, 'Sorry, the Doctor has denied your referrral.' No communication at all....just completely ignored with not one word of communication.
'Takes Care'? Of what? Certainly not the mental health of those referred to them for care. Communication is the most simple and basic responsibility of not only any business, but most certainly any business focused on the mental health of vulnerable people. What a complete and utter lack of decency, courtesy and basic human respect to just leave people with mental health referrals rotting while they wait for a never to come courtesy phone call.

I sent through my GP referral letter requesting an appointment with Dr Goki via email to Takes Care Specialist Centre and did not receive a response for weeks. I called to follow up and the staff member seemed rather annoyed by the phone call and said that they were busy and she would not be able to tell me when they could get back to me.

Over 3 weeks after calling the clinic I received a phone call to say a different psychiatrist within the clinic has accepted my referral letter (which was specifically addressed to Dr Goki) and that an appointment could be scheduled. I asked if Dr Goki accepted my referral letter and was told he has not seen it. I asked why he did not receive my referral letter to which I did not get a response other than to take this other appointment. I asked again if he could see my referral letter and it took over a month from sending my referral letter via email and follow up phone calls before Dr Goki received the referral letter.

After the referral letter was accepted by him, the next available appointment was in 3 months’ time. After this initial consultation, I required a medical file for my follow up appointment. I had filled out the paperwork at the end of my initial consultation, however it was not correct so I received a call from the clinic weeks later and they sent the form to which I filled out straight away and sent back that day.

Two days prior to the follow up appointment the clinic called me to say they have not received the file and would have to cancel if it does not come through prior to the scheduled appointment. I asked if they contacted directly to follow up regarding my medical file to which they said no. I called myself after receiving this news only to find out it was sent to Takes Care Specialist Centre the week prior. I called Takes Care Specialist Centre back to inform them it was already sent out last week and the lady laughed and said “oh yes I found it”. After this encounter I sent them an email to say how frustrating the process has been from trying to make an initial consultation to the phone call just received saying they will cancel the appointment, yet they didn’t even bother reaching out directly to follow up or look at their inbox as it was already received by the time they called me.

For my follow up appointment, the first 10 minutes Dr Goki lectured me regarding how I had treated his administration staff and that it wasn’t acceptable.

After the second appointment I cancelled my follow up appointment and reached out to 5 different clinics, all of which responded back to me via email or phone call within two business days advising if they had availability or not.

Overall, the entire experience with Takes Care Specialist Centre was horrendous and I am genuinely shocked by their attitudes and the level of unprofessionalism and rudeness encountered.

I recently found out another young female had a terrible experience and is putting through an official complaint. Earlier in the year, the clinic had apologised to me and said they would do better for future patients. This clearly isn’t the case which has prompted me to make this public complaint.
